Stitching with students and teachers at the UVA in Amsterdam

During the initiation week, September 2024, at the University of Amsterdam, the XL stitching project brought new students and teachers together in a joyful and creative way.
Two large abstract panels were created, symbolizing the beautiful diversity within the student community.
With soft colors and gentle, flowing shapes, the artworks reflect a sense of openness and connection. The energy during the stitching sessions was amazing, as hands from all backgrounds worked side by side.
The finished pieces now proudly hang in the university, serving as a lasting reminder of unity, creativity, and the start of something new.
